This class defines the wrapper for the checksum management interface. It should be used as the base class for a stacked plugin. When used that way, the shared library holding the plugin must define a "C" entry point named XrdCksAdd2() as described at the end of this include file. Note you pass a reference to the previous plugin-in in the plug-in chain as a constructor argument as supplied to the XrdCksAdd2() function. Override the methods you wish to wrap. Methods that are not overridden are forwarded to the previous plug-in.

Calculate a new checksum for a physical file using the checksum algorithm named in the Cks parameter.
Xfn | The logical or physical name of the file to be checksumed. |
Cks | For input, it specifies the checksum algorithm to be used. For output, the checksum value is returned upon success. |
doSet | When true, the new value must replace any existing value in the Xfn's extended file attributes. |
pcbP | In the second form, the pointer to the callback object. A nil pointer does not invoke any callback. |

Fully initialize the manager which includes loading any plugins.
ConfigFN | Points to the configuration file path. |
DfltCalc | Is the default checksum and should be defaulted if NULL. The default implementation defaults this to adler32. A default is only needed should the checksum name in the XrdCksData object be omitted. |

List names of the checksums associated with a Xfn or all supported ones.
Xfn | The logical or physical file name whose checksum names are to be returned. When Xfn is null, return all supported checksum algorithm names. |
Buff | Points to a buffer, at least 64 bytes in length, to hold a "Sep" separated list of checksum names. |
Blen | The length of the buffer. |
Sep | The separation character to be used between adjacent names. |

Get a new XrdCksCalc object that can calculate the checksum corresponding to the specified name or the default object if name is a null pointer. The object can be used to compute checksums on the fly. The object's Recycle() method must be used to delete it.
name | The name of the checksum algorithm. If null, use the default one. |

Retreive the checksum from the Xfn's xattrs and compare it to the supplied checksum. If the checksum is not available or is stale, a new checksum is calculated and written to the extended attributes.
Xfn | The logical or physical name of the file to be verified. |
Cks | Specifies the checksum name and value. |
pcbP | In the second form, the pointer to the callback object. A nil pointer does not invoke any callback. |
